In the charming town of Pakrac by the Pakra River, there stood an old episcopal palace, a witness to history. Despite its impressive walls and beautiful architecture, the palace had seen the wear and tear of time. The local community decided to stop its decline and start fixing up the palace. It was hard work, but builders, architects, and history experts came together to restore this important cultural site. They used Baumit products for the restoration, known for keeping historical buildings true to their roots. By studying old materials and building techniques, they made sure to preserve the spirit of the past. Thanks to Baumit, not only did they get high-quality materials for the restoration, but they also made the palace more energy-efficient.
